**Q: Do I need to register my event schema before publishing to the Tidewell bus?**

A: Yes. Every event type must have a schema registered in the Hollis registry before the broker will accept messages. Registration enforces backward compatibility: you can add optional fields freely, but removing or retyping a field requires a new major version and a migration note. The CI check handles validation automatically on merge. Registration steps and compatibility rules are documented here:

wiki page, bagaf-fawip: https://harbor.tolvaqsys.local/pages/repo/pages/secrets/eac969ffc71f356b

Postmortem Timeline — Project Ledgerline Dedup

14:05 — Dedup job merged customer records on a stale similarity index, collapsing distinct accounts. 14:22 — On-call paused the queue. 14:40 — Index rebuild initiated; merge audit log confirmed no data left the boundary. 15:10 — Reversal script restored affected records. The run responsible is identified by the trace value below.

trace token, tawep-fahif: htk3_b58

- [ ] Step 7: Archive cold storage buckets (Glacierline tier). Confirm both ceremony witnesses are present, verify bucket manifests match the Oxbow ledger, then seal the archive key shares. Plugin authors may observe but not handle shares. Once sealed, the archive index itself is encrypted and can only be reopened with the passphrase below.

vault phrase of badup-hahig = tamael-aldael-kelmir-istael-fenok-istwyn-tamius-jorath-oliion

Step 4: Configure the Sproutwise scheduler service. Plugin authors deploying against the staging greenhouse must run the scheduler with moisture polling enabled, so set POLL_INTERVAL_SECONDS to 300 or lower and confirm ZONE_MAP points at your plugin's zone manifest. The scheduler authenticates to the valve-control bus with a token read from its environment file at boot; without it, watering jobs will queue but never fire. Append the following line to that file now.

vault entry, yahif-yajep: COURIER_KEY29=b802bdf8034096b65a51c6ba5abe2